Abstract

Based on the U-Net encoding and decoding structure, a more improved version of this model can be developed. An improved version of this encoder-decoder model has been developed based on the U-Net encoder-decoder structure. First of all, we replace all convolutions in the model with depthwise separable convolutions in the end-to-end training phase in order to reduce the total number of parameters and computations in the model. The second part of the work proposes the use of a Bottleneck Coordinate Attention Module (BCAM) in order to overcome the problems caused by depthwise separable convolutions being a source of accuracy reductions. By combining the advantages of both the Bottleneck Residual Block (BRB) and Coordinate Attention Mechanism (CAM), BCAM is able to extract deeper features in higher-dimensional space as well as embed coordinate information into the channel attention mechanism in order to extract more information over a wider area. As a result of the experimental results, it has been found that the parameters of the proposed method have declined by approximately 65% when compared to U-Net, and the proposed method achieves an intersection rate of 91.2% when compared to U-Net.
